I will contest on Cong ticket from Fatehgarh Sahib: Rai Singh

Font Size

Express News Service

Posted: Feb 18, 2009 at 0203 hrs IST

Khanna Rai Singh, a retired IAS officer and a native of Sirhind declared confidence in getting a nod from the Congress to contest the Fatehgarh (Reserve) constituency in the forthcoming Lok Sabha elections.

Talking to mediapersons, he said: “I have gone through the envelope which contains the name of the party candidate from Fatehgarh Sahib and it has my name.”

He added: “I decided to contest the election after getting directions from the party high command.” When asked about his contenders, Singh said: “I had a talk with former PPCC president Shamsher Singh Dullo, who told me he is not interested in contesting from Fatehgarh Sahib and has requested the high command that he is willing to contest from Hoshiarpur or Jalandhar.”

Singh retired from Uttar Pradesh as a chief secretary rank officer.

He said: “Chief Minister Parkash Singh Badal has appointed his family members and relatives at various levels.” He further alleged that the CBI and the Central Board of Direct Taxes are not performing their duties to nail the corrupt practices of the Badal family.

He threatened to file a public interest litigation (PIL) in the Punjab and Haryana High Court if they failed to perform their duties.”

Singh added, “I have toured all the nine assembly constituencies which are under the Fatehgarh Sahib constituency and received a tremendous response from people.”
